Kingsmen Show Off Their Depth - Sweep St. Katherines

THOUSAND OAKS, Calif. —California Lutheran University Men's Volleyball played host to the University of St Katherine Firebirds tonight. The match was never in doubt as the Kingsmen took a 3-0 sweep 25-14, 25-15, 25-15. Cal Lutheran was able to show off some depth with 15 different Kingsmen recording a kill in the match.

Through a combination of tough serving and lots of block touches helped the Kingsmen control the Firebird offense and force them into errors. On the match, Cal Lutheran held St. Katherines to a -.051 hitting percentage. The Kingsmen totaled 8 blocks and forced 22 errors.

Solid passing and defense in the back row allowed Cal Lutheran to stay in system for most of the match. Working with their options, Kingsmen setters were able to distribute opportunities throughout the roster, en route to 30 total kills and a .207 team hitting percentage.

The top scorers for the match were Max Strehl and Ryker Linn who added 7 points each.

The Kingsmen will be back in action on Friday February 4 when they host The Master's University at 7:00pm.
